非线性系统超谐共振周期响应的数值模拟问题

摘    要:以相平面、时域响应辅以FFT等方法研究了同时具有二次和三次非线弹性的振动系统的超谐共振数值模拟问题.在一般初值条件下,无阻尼系统的共振响应含一长拍,弱阻尼系统的共振响应有一长过渡过程.本文提供了时域响应立即进入周期态的方法,从而大大提高了工程应用中FFT的精度和可实现性.

On the Numerical Simulation of Periodic Superharmonic-Resonant Responses of Nonlinear Vibrating Systems

Abstract:The superharmonic resonant responses of the vibrating Systems with nonlinear elasticity of the 2nd and 3rd powers are numerically studied on the phase plane and in the original coordinates in time domain, supplemented with FFT.The resonant responses for general initial conditions are found being accompanied by long beats in the undamped systems and by long transient in the weakly-damped systems.A method is examined for immediately entering essentially-periodic responses.The feasibility and accuracy of FFTare greatly achieved in engineering.
